Description:

Tanner Clinic has an immediate opening for a part-time PRN Breast Ultrasound Tech at our Layton B location.

Essential Job Responsibilities:

  • Perform breast ultrasounds
  • Ensure patients are properly prepared for exams and procedures.
  • Ensure all finished ultrasound exams are of high diagnostic quality and all administrative work for each exam is in order.
  • Recognize and document abnormalities and anomalies.
  • Effectively and compassionately communicate with patients, physicians, and radiologists.
  • Reviews patient’s medical history and physician’s instructions. Prepares equipment for procedure. Selects appropriate equipment settings. Explains procedure to patient and records any medical history that may be relevant to the condition being viewed. Directs the patient to move into positions for image quality.
  • Spreads gel on the skin to aid the transmission of sound waves.
  • Operates equipment to direct non-ionizing, high-frequency sound waves into areas of the patient’s body. The equipment collects reflected echoes and forms an image that may be recorded, transmitted, and imaged for interpretation and diagnosis by a radiologist.
  • Views the prior ultrasound imaging, and ability to correlate with mammography images. Selects images to show to the physician for diagnostic purposes. Able to measure and communicate features of the area imaged.
  • Keeps patient records and adjusts/maintains equipment.
  • Complies with safety, infection control, and quality improvement policies/procedures.
  • Other duties as assigned.
